The work behind fireplace repair in Port Salerno
Here is what we actually do on a Port Salerno fireplace repair. Common work: replacing cracked firebrick and refractory panels, re-parging or rebuilding the smoke chamber, repairing the damper or throat, and sealing cracks that let smoke and heat into the wall. We test draft before and after. This close to the Manatee Pocket, that means assuming salt-air corrosion on every exposed metal part — cap, flashing, and damper. Signs you may need fireplace repair: Smoke pushing into the room, a fireplace that will not draw, or visible cracks in the firebox are the usual reasons Port Salerno homeowners call.

Why fireplace repair matters in Port Salerno
On a Port Salerno chimney, the reason to act is straightforward. A cracked firebox, failing refractory, or bad damper lets heat reach surfaces it should not, turning a cosmetic problem into a fire-safety one if the fireplace keeps getting used.
Port Salerno wraps around the Manatee Pocket near the St. Lucie Inlet to the Atlantic, so its waterfront homes endure salt-laden inlet air that speeds rusting of chimney caps and dampers and makes annual exterior inspections worthwhile. Near the Manatee Pocket, Port Salerno housing sets the terms for a fireplace repair: Older Florida fishing-village cottages and ranch homes alongside newer waterfront houses, mostly block-and-stucco with masonry chimneys.
